2006-09-27introduce delta objects with offset to baseNicolas Pitre
This adds a new object, namely OBJ_OFS_DELTA, renames OBJ_DELTA to OBJ_REF_DELTA to better make the distinction between those two delta objects, and adds support for the handling of those new delta objects in sha1_file.c only. The OBJ_OFS_DELTA contains a relative offset from the delta object's position in a pack instead of the 20-byte SHA1 reference to identify the base object. Since the base is likely to be not so far away, the relative offset is more likely to have a smaller encoding on average than an absolute offset. And for those delta objects the base must always be stored first because there is no way to know the distance of later objects when streaming a pack. Hence this relative offset is always meant to be negative. The offset encoding is slightly denser than the one used for object size -- credits to <linux@horizon.com> (whoever this is) for bringing it to my attention. This allows for pack size reduction between 3.2% (Linux-2.6) to over 5% (linux-historic). Runtime pack access should be faster too since delta replay does skip a search in the pack index for each delta in a chain. 2006-09-07pack-objects --unpacked=<existing pack> option.Junio C Hamano
Incremental repack without -a essentially boils down to: rev-list --objects --unpacked --all | pack-objects $new_pack which picks up all loose objects that are still live and creates a new pack. This implements --unpacked=<existing pack> option to tell the revision walking machinery to pretend as if objects in such a pack are unpacked for the purpose of object listing. With this, we could say: rev-list --objects --unpacked=$active_pack --all | pack-objects $new_pack instead, to mean "all live loose objects but pretend as if objects that are in this pack are also unpacked". The newly created pack would be perfect for updating $active_pack by replacing it. Since pack-objects now knows how to do the rev-list's work itself internally, you can also write the above example by: pack-objects --unpacked=$active_pack --all $new_pack </dev/null Signed-off-by: Junio C Hamano <junkio@cox.net>

2006-07-14sha1_file: add the ability to parse objects in "pack file format"Linus Torvalds
The pack-file format is slightly different from the traditional git object format, in that it has a much denser binary header encoding. The traditional format uses an ASCII string with type and length information, which is somewhat wasteful. A new object format starts with uncompressed binary header followed by compressed payload -- this will allow us later to copy the payload straight to packfiles. Obviously they cannot be read by older versions of git, so for now new object files are created with the traditional format. core.legacyheaders configuration item, when set to false makes the code write in new format for people to experiment with. 2006-07-03Make zlib compression level configurable, and change default.Joachim B Haga
With the change in default, "git add ." on kernel dir is about twice as fast as before, with only minimal (0.5%) change in object size. The speed difference is even more noticeable when committing large files, which is now up to 8 times faster. The configurability is through setting core.compression = [-1..9] which maps to the zlib constants; -1 is the default, 0 is no compression, and 1..9 are various speed/size tradeoffs, 9 being slowest. 2006-06-02handle concurrent pruning of packed objectsJeff King
This patch causes read_sha1_file and sha1_object_info to re-examine the list of packs if an object cannot be found. It works by re-running prepare_packed_git() after an object fails to be found. It does not attempt to clean up the old pack list. Old packs which are in use can continue to be used (until unused by lru selection). New packs are placed at the front of the list and will thus be examined before old packs. Signed-off-by: Jeff King <peff@peff.net> Signed-off-by: Junio C Hamano <junkio@cox.net>
